  2. Open the Alexa App . Select Devices . Select your device. Select Device Settings . Select Change next to Wi-Fi Network. You can then: Connect to one of your previously connected Wi-Fi networks. Forget a previously connected Wi-Fi network. Select Join another Wi-Fi Network to change to a new one.

  7. Note: If your device loses its Internet connection and won't reconnect, first try to Restart Your Alexa Enabled Device. If that doesn't work, or if your device has intermittent connectivity issues, try the following steps to resolve most Wi-Fi issues: Make sure that your Echo device is within 30 feet (or 10 meters) of your wireless router.
